How classical attachment theories relate to AI companions

The concept of attachment is traditionally rooted in human-to-human relationships. According to Bowlby’s model the need for safety and emotional support in human relations.

When this framework is applied to relationships with artificial companions, one can see how individuals might attribute emotional significance towards AI that simulate presence and support.

Researchers applied attachment theory concepts to understand the unique aspects of AI companionship. They reveal people instantiate attachment-like feelings despite the AI’s artificiality.

Especially, the need for emotional security and presence are vital in conceptualizing AI as attachment figures.

What drives humans to form psychological bonds with AI

Numerous factors influence development of emotional ties to AI agents. Key factors span internal motivations, AI characteristics, environmental settings, and personal traits.

  • Loneliness and social needs: People may turn to AI to ease feelings of isolation.
  • Anthropomorphism and personalization: Giving AI human-like traits and responses encourages emotional bonding.
  • Perceived reliability and responsiveness: AI that responds effectively encourages user reliance and bonds.
  • Psychological projection and needs fulfillment: People often use AI as mirrors for self-expression and emotional support.
  • Cultural and contextual factors: Contextual acceptance shapes how attachments to AI develop.

Understanding these drivers helps shape better AI companions and therapies.
